Understanding the Basics of Home Lighting

Grasping the essentials of home lighting is key to utilising it effectively, particularly when you’re aiming to sell your home. The foundation of good lighting is understanding the balance between natural light, warm light, cold light, and the various types of bulbs available. Natural light is invaluable; it can make spaces appear larger and more welcoming. Maximising natural light can be achieved through strategic placement of mirrors and the use of light, reflective colours.

Warm light creates a cosy and inviting atmosphere, ideal for living rooms and bedrooms where comfort is paramount. Cold light, on the other hand, is better suited to bathrooms and kitchens, offering a clearer, more vibrant light that aids in tasks requiring attention to detail. The choice between warm and cold light can significantly affect the perceived atmosphere of a room.

The type of bulb used is equally important. LED bulbs, for example, are energy-efficient and long-lasting, making them a cost-effective choice for home lighting. They are available in a range of colour temperatures, allowing for greater flexibility in achieving the desired ambiance in each room.

Understanding these basics allows homeowners to make informed decisions about lighting their home, thereby enhancing its appeal to potential buyers. A well-lit home not only looks more inviting but can also give the impression of a well-maintained and cared-for property, increasing its marketability. With this foundational knowledge, homeowners in Daventry can effectively use lighting to improve their home’s selling potential, making it stand out in the property market.

Entrance and Hallway Lighting Ideas

Kicking off our list of Amazing Lighting Ideas for your Daventry Home. The entrance and hallway serve as the initial glimpse into your home, setting the tone for the rest of the property. To make this area inviting, soft, warm lighting is advisable. It creates a welcoming ambiance that can positively influence a potential buyer’s first impression. Wall sconces, pendant lights, and even chandeliers are excellent options for these spaces, offering both aesthetic appeal and practical illumination.

Opting for fixtures that can be adjusted or have dimmable features allows for flexibility, enabling you to alter the atmosphere depending on the time of day or specific needs. Additionally, consider the scale and design of the lighting fixtures in relation to the size of the entrance and hallway to ensure they complement the space rather than overwhelm it.

For narrower or smaller hallways, wall-mounted fixtures can save space while still providing sufficient light. In larger areas, a statement piece such as a chandelier or a series of pendant lights can add a touch of elegance and character. The key is to balance functionality with design, ensuring the space is both beautifully lit and welcoming to visitors.

Lighting in these areas not only guides guests into your home but also highlights architectural features and decor, making the entrance and hallway an integral part of the home’s overall aesthetic and appeal. By carefully selecting the right lighting solutions, you can enhance these areas to make a strong, positive impact on anyone stepping into your home.

Living Room Lighting Tricks

Creating the perfect atmosphere in your living room is all about balance. A mix of overhead lighting, floor lamps, and table lamps can introduce layers to your space, giving it depth and a warm feel. Dimmer switches are a fantastic addition, offering the flexibility to alter brightness levels to match the occasion, whether you’re hosting a lively gathering or settling down for a quiet evening.

For those keen on showcasing specific features or artworks, consider directional spotlights or track lighting. These options allow you to highlight the best parts of your living room, drawing attention to the areas you’re most proud of. It’s a simple trick that can change the room’s focus and mood.

The use of soft, warm light is particularly effective in living rooms. It invites relaxation and comfort, making it an ideal setting for unwinding after a long day. For a more dynamic setup, mixing warm light with occasional cooler tones can add contrast and interest to your living area, without overwhelming it with too much brightness.

Consider the arrangement of your furniture and how light plays into this configuration. Positioning lamps behind or next to seating areas can create cosy nooks for reading or conversation, enhancing the room’s functionality while also contributing to its overall ambiance.

Remember, the goal is to make your living room a versatile space where lighting adapts to your needs, setting the right mood for every occasion. By carefully selecting and positioning your light sources, you can achieve a living room that not only looks appealing but also feels welcoming and comfortable.

Kitchen Lighting Solutions

In the kitchen, the focus is on combining practicality with style. Efficient task lighting is paramount, ensuring that cooking and food preparation areas are well-lit. Under-cupboard lighting is a smart choice, providing direct light to counter surfaces without creating shadows. This can be particularly effective in areas where precision tasks, like chopping or measuring ingredients, take place.

Pendant lights above islands or dining areas serve a dual purpose, offering both functional lighting for eating and preparation, as well as adding a design element that can complement the kitchen’s aesthetics. These fixtures should be adjustable in terms of height and intensity to accommodate different activities and times of day.

Recessed lighting, strategically placed, can illuminate the entire kitchen space evenly, avoiding the pitfall of having dark corners or areas. The versatility of LED bulbs makes them an excellent option for kitchen lighting; they are not only energy-efficient but also come in a range of colour temperatures, allowing you to tailor the mood of the kitchen from warm for a cosy dinner to bright and cool for meal prep.

For those with kitchen cabinets that do not reach the ceiling, installing LED strips on top can add an ambient glow that enhances the sense of space. It’s an indirect lighting solution that can make the kitchen feel more open and inviting.

Remember, the key is layering different types of lighting to achieve a functional yet welcoming kitchen environment. By picking the right fittings and positioning light fixtures well, you can transform your kitchen into a space that is not only practical for everyday tasks but also enjoyable to spend time in.

Bedroom Lighting for Comfort and Style

Next in our list of Amazing Lighting Ideas for your Daventry Home, the bedroom! The bedroom is a personal retreat where lighting should foster both relaxation and functionality. To achieve this, a blend of different lighting types is essential. Overhead lighting offers general illumination, but it’s the use of bedside lamps and wall-mounted sconces that introduces an element of versatility, allowing for softer light when reading or winding down before sleep. Incorporating dimmable lights into the bedroom design affords the ability to tailor brightness levels, catering to a range of activities from the comfort of your bed.

When selecting lights, consider both the placement and the style of the fixtures. Bedside lamps should be easily accessible, offering enough light for reading without straining the eyes, while wall sconces can provide directed light that doesn’t disturb a sleeping partner. Overhead lights with a dimmer switch can adjust the room’s ambiance instantly, making the bedroom adaptable to different times of day or moods.

For those looking to enhance the aesthetic appeal alongside functionality, choosing lighting fixtures that reflect the bedroom’s decor can add to the room’s charm and character. Whether opting for modern minimalism with sleek lines and LED bulbs or a more traditional approach with warm-toned light and ornate designs, the key is in creating a harmonious balance.

Efficiently layered lighting not only elevates the bedroom’s comfort and style but also contributes to a serene and inviting atmosphere, crucial for relaxation and rest.

Outdoor Lighting Ideas

Outdoor lighting serves not only as a practical solution for navigating your property after dark but also significantly boosts the aesthetic appeal of your home, crucial for those looking to sell in Daventry.

Strategically placed pathway lights guide visitors safely to your door, whilst garden spotlights can accentuate landscaping features, adding depth and intrigue to your outdoor space. Porch lights welcome guests and provide security, creating a feeling of safety and hospitality.

Incorporating timers or motion sensors with these lighting solutions offers both convenience and efficiency, ensuring lights are only on when needed. This thoughtful approach to outdoor lighting not only highlights your home’s best features during evening hours but also contributes to creating a positive impression on potential buyers, enhancing the property’s kerb appeal.

With these considerations in mind, outdoor lighting becomes an essential element of home presentation, marrying form with function to showcase your property in its best light.
